RECRUITING
THE FORTY-FIFTH R-EINFOECB. MENTS. At the end of last week 5559 men had been posted to 'the August, September, October, and November reinforcements. The men were distributed as follows:—
Forty-Afth draft '(August) 1438 Forty-sixth draft (September) 1838 Forty-seventh draft (October) 11-18 Forty-sight" draft (November) 835 \
5559 The Forty-fifth Reinforcements are now beiiiK mobilised. The quota from Group 5 (Wellington City and Suburbs) assembled at the ISuckie Street Barracks yesterday afternoon. The number of men talied was 18-1, and of these 17G were present. After the roll had been called and the men had been addressed 'by the Group Commander, the recruits wero given leavo until this morning:. They will proceed to camp this morning. Tho great majority of them are Second Division men. (
